Thinking about buying in West Haven? Now could not be a better time, with 663 residential properties there's certainly plenty to choose from. The average property price in this area is in the region of $704,000 with prices in this suburb ranging from $22,000 to $2,613,000. West Haven is located fairly close to the coast at just 0Km so as well as great views of the ocean and access to beaches, demand and valuations are likely to be a bit higher here.
In West Haven there has been a history of lower than average prices and demand, offering opportunities for investors or first home owners, especially in the context of the growth in working from home. Low average incomes in West Haven is reflected in smaller and lower quality accommodation. Over time this may change providsing long-term returns but in the short to medium term, prices are likely to be less than state averages. The slightly lower than average earnings from occupations in West Haven changes the housing and lifestyle preference. It is more a matter of what can be afforded rather than what would we prefer, leading to slower price increases over time. Low population density implies low demand and limits housing choices and price increases. Could be a good entry point for first home buyers needing to somehow get into the market. Lower than average industry presence in West Haven we believe will be less of a negative impact than it has in the past. Post-COVID and the growth in working from home has lessened the demand for local employment options. This may make West Haven a better buying opportunity than it may have been in the past.

The housing market in West Haven is characterized by a mix of properties, ranging from modern family homes to charming older cottages. In recent years, this area has seen steady interest from buyers owing to its scenic surroundings and relative affordability compared to more urban locales. The real estate market here, while competitive, typically offers better value for money, drawing both retirees seeking tranquility and young families eager to establish roots in an engaging community. Accessibility to essential amenities and development plans focused on enhancing local infrastructure have further bolstered West Haven’s appeal as a residential destination.
Living in West Haven offers residents a lifestyle imbued with a sense of relaxation and connection with nature. With proximity to the Hastings River and nearby beaches, locals enjoy various recreational opportunities, from fishing and boating to simply basking in the sublime coastal scenery. The community itself is known for its friendly, laid-back atmosphere, where neighborhood gatherings and community events are commonplace, fostering a strong sense of belonging among residents. Despite its serene ambiance, West Haven provides convenient access to schools, shops, and healthcare facilities in nearby towns, ensuring residents do not have to compromise on practical living needs. The blend of natural beauty, community spirit, and modern conveniences makes West Haven a desirable place to call home.

| (mm) RAIN | Min (°C) TEMP | Max (°C) TEMP | Min (%) HUMIDITY | Max (%) HUMIDITY | (m/sec) WIND | (MJ/sq m) SOLAR |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 4.0 | 20.8 | 28.8 | 60.0 | 88.6 | 5.2 | 24.1 |
| Feb | 10.5 | 20.1 | 28.1 | 60.8 | 91.2 | 4.5 | 19.3 |
| Mar | 11.9 | 18.9 | 26.7 | 63.1 | 92.5 | 4.5 | 15.8 |
| Apr | 4.3 | 15.2 | 24.7 | 56.4 | 92.5 | 3.8 | 14.9 |
| May | 3.0 | 12 | 22.6 | 52.9 | 92.2 | 3.4 | 12.3 |
| Jun | 3.3 | 9.8 | 20.1 | 54.0 | 91.5 | 3.7 | 11.0 |
| Jul | 1.1 | 7.7 | 20.2 | 47.3 | 92.9 | 3.4 | 12 |
| Aug | 1.7 | 8.0 | 21.2 | 43.0 | 92.0 | 3.7 | 15.2 |
| Sept | 2.1 | 11.3 | 22.9 | 46.7 | 90.2 | 4.5 | 17.7 |
| Oct | 3.5 | 14.0 | 24.1 | 53.8 | 90.7 | 4.6 | 20.7 |
| Nov | 1.2 | 16.5 | 26.5 | 49.8 | 87.5 | 5.1 | 24.9 |
| Dec | 6.5 | 19.0 | 27.4 | 57.9 | 88.5 | 5.2 | 23.0 |
source: Australian Government Bureau of Meteorology
